Fantom Launches Canonical Stablecoin USDC.e Powered by Wormhole and Circle
🚀 Bridged Stablecoin Arrives

Fantom has announced the launch of its canonical stablecoin USDC.e, a bridged version of USDC on the Wormhole network. USDC.e is bridged from native USDC on Ethereum and can potentially be upgraded to native USDC by Circle in the future. The initiative aims to reduce liquidity fragmentation, introduce stability, and provide additional on-ramps onto the Fantom ecosystem. Developers can build on USDC.e without needing to change code if it upgrades to native USDC. Users can store, pay, trade, borrow, and lend with USDC.e, which would automatically become native USDC upon an upgrade. Fantom and Circle will provide liquidity for USDC.e on Wormhole, making it accessible for bridging assets to Fantom.

Sonic Labs Innovator Fund Announces New Grant Recipients

The Sonic Labs Innovator Fund has unveiled its latest grant recipients, offering up to 200M $S for new ventures and dApps migrating to Sonic. The new partners include: - PaintSwap: Building a marketplace for trading Sonic airdrops, featuring ERC-1155 fNFT and an advanced order book. - Equalizer Exchange: A DEX with a vote escrowed model to drive liquidity to high-volume token pairs. - SilverSwap: A DeFi hub supporting dynamic fees, concentrated liquidity, rebase tokens, and plugins. These dApps will be available on Sonic at launch. The fund aims to accelerate innovation and ensure top dApps migrate to the new Sonic chain.
OpenBlock Labs Partners with Sonic for Airdrop

OpenBlock Labs, crypto's incentive operating system, partners with Sonic for a 190,500,000 $S airdrop across multiple phases. OpenBlock specializes in creating and deploying incentive campaigns for various protocols. They manage over $2 billion in annual incentive spend and have a team of 45 engineers and researchers. The partnership aims to optimize incentive models and identify genuine users for long-term contributions to the Sonic network. OpenBlock will provide anti-Sybil protection, including exploitative behavior detection, wash trading detection, and volume profiling. This collaboration ensures fair rewards distribution for users, developers, and validators on Opera and Sonic.

Fantom's Sonic Labs to Bolster Ecosystem with Five New Projects

Fantom's Sonic Labs program has selected five new projects to receive funding and support. The projects are Lynx Protocol (perpetuals DEX), Thunder Dome (SocialFi platform), Debita Finance (P2P lending), Kiri Coin (green-tech startup), and Froqorion (party-based RPG). Each project will receive 200,000 FTM tokens, mentorship from Andre Cronje, guidance from Pyth Network's Kemar Titi, and compliance, payroll, and legal support. These projects are expected to further diversify and strengthen Fantom's ecosystem.
